    I just bought a 1964 econoline pickup and i cant seem to find any info on how many were built in 1964. The body style is the 87a (with the nice blind spots lol), 170 engine, and 3 on the tree. Anybody know how many of these were built that year?

    Here's the numbers on Econoline pickup production I have.

    1961 14893
    1962 8140
    1963 11394
    1964 5184
    1965 7405
    1966 3090
    1967 2015

    Most 61's pickups are early production as Ford expected pickups to outsell vans much the same way pickups outsold panel trucks in the 50's. After the van sales took off pickup production slowed way down.

    63 Production was up due to a large order from the Air Force.

    65 Production was up due to Spring Specials.

    I can bust them down a little bit but not by windows. I have standard and custom numbers. Either could be had in a 3 or 5 window cab.


    Standard Custom
    61 11893 3000
    62 Not specified
    63 10372 1022
    64 4196 988
    65 4340 3065 Spring Specials were customs
    66 2578 512
    67 1697 318

    It's a real gray area as to what made a custom a custom. It basically boils down to the seat upholstery. On 61-62's, woven upholstery is custom, embossed is standard. I was wrong and the windows. All customs have five window cabs but not all five windows were customs. Other items in the custom list were left side door lock, deluxe steering wheel and horn ring. All opitions were available seperate as well. After 63 the custom was identified in the data plate. A 63 87A on the data plate for standard, 87B for a custom. A standard truck will have a number prefix on the trim code. A custom will have a letter prefix on the same code.
